During a tense board meeting called by Mr. Scott, Elsie unveils a bold marketing plan proposing an $8 million investment to dominate the high-end market in three months. The company is pressured to support Elsie's strategy, framed as crucial for growth. Linda, unexpectedly present and often belittled by Elsie, publicly challenges the plan, calling it wasteful hype. This provokes Mr. Scott's anger and escalates the conflict, highlighting Linda's contentious standing. The episode ends with Linda defiantly standing her ground, setting up a clash over the company’s future direction.
